Book Synopsis



Discover the joy and meaning of the magical festival of Diwali, a very special time for people all around the world.

Sonali and her brother Jay are inviting you to celebrate with them! Join in as they make rangoli patterns, cook up a feast with their nani and nana, and visit all their friends and family with gifts and delicious treats.

Along the way, you'll learn how Diwali is a fun five-day celebration, all about the victory of light over darkness, good over evil, and knowledge over ignorance.

This bright, engaging, and heart-warming book covers:

  • The preparations on Dhanteras
  • The cooking and baking on Kali Chaudas
  • The delicious feast and fireworks on Diwali
  • The special breakfast and gifts on Nutan Varsh
  • The celebration of the bond between brothers and sisters on Bhai Beej

...and the joy and excitement of this spectacular festival are brought to life with:

  • A salt dough diva recipe
  • Instructions to make a rangoli pattern
  • A colorful fact-file
  • A fun quiz to complete together

In this immersive exploration of Diwali, kids join a family as they celebrate this vibrant festival. A simple way to introduce little ones to this important occasion, guided by young children who are celebrating.

Part of the Celebrations & Festivals series, you are invited into a family's celebrations as you explore the magic and excitement of religious and cultural festivals around the world.
